Binance Research Says 500,000 Bitcoin Left Exchanges as Balances Hit Six-Year Low

According to Binance Research, Bitcoin held on exchanges fell from 17.6% to 15.0%, marking the lowest exchange balance level in six years.

Summary

Binance Research reported that 500,000 Bitcoin has permanently exited cryptocurrency exchanges. The update said exchange-held Bitcoin balances dropped from 17.6% to 15.0%, reaching their lowest level in six years. Lower exchange balances are commonly watched as a market supply indicator because they can suggest more Bitcoin is being moved into self-custody (personal wallet storage) or long-term holding rather than kept readily available for trading.

Terms & Concepts
  • Exchange balances: The share of cryptocurrency held on trading platforms, often tracked to assess available market supply and potential selling liquidity.
  • Self-custody: Holding crypto in a personal wallet instead of on an exchange, giving the owner direct control of the assets.
  • Bitcoin supply on exchanges: A market metric used to monitor how much Bitcoin remains readily tradable on centralized platforms.
